Shielding HVAC Control Platforms : A Primer to Digital Protection

Today's Building Control Systems (BMS) are increasingly reliant on cyber infrastructure, making them open to cyber risks . Implementing robust defenses is essential for maintaining continuous functionality . This demands a layered strategy including regular software revisions, powerful access procedures , perimeter isolation , and staff training on emerging online threat dangers . Preventative recognition and resolution abilities are equally necessary to lessen potential disruptions and protect vital data .

BMS Cybersecurity: Best Practices for Building Operation

Securing a Property Management System ( Automated Control System) is increasingly paramount. Effective cybersecurity protocols should more info encompass several essential practices. These often involve regular vulnerability evaluations, enforcing strong password policies, isolating the network to limit potential breaches, and implementing intrusion detection systems. Furthermore, proactive monitoring, personnel training on data protection awareness, and establishing a comprehensive crisis plan are crucial to safeguarding the confidentiality and accessibility of building systems .
